What is Window Restoration?
Window restoration is a process that aims to repair and invigorate existing windows rather than replace them completely. This service can include a range of jobs, consisting of fixing broken glass, fixing damaged frames, and bring back the operational mechanisms (like sashes and locks) of windows. The goal is to boost the looks and performance of the windows while protecting their initial character and appeal.

The window weatherstripping repair restoration procedure can differ based on the specific needs of the windows and the services being utilized. Nevertheless, a typical restoration may follow these crucial actions:
Assessment: A professional will inspect the windows to identify their condition and identify any concerns that require addressing. This assessment helps to identify whether restoration is possible or if replacement is essential.
Preparation: The location surrounding the window is prepared to ensure a tidy workplace. This might include eliminating any window treatments and securing the surrounding surface areas.
Repairs: Depending on the assessment, repairs may consist of:
Replacing broken glassReinforcing or repairing harmed framesChanging or fixing window mechanisms, such as sashes and locks
Weatherization: New weatherstripping may be contributed to enhance insulation and energy effectiveness.
Completing Touches: Finally, the windows might be painted or stained, permitting modification to match the home's visual.
Final Inspection: The brought back windows are inspected for performance, making sure that whatever runs smoothly and effectively.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How do I know if my windows are prospects for restoration?
If your windows remain in good structural condition, even if they have some cosmetic imperfections (like peeling paint or small cracks), they might be suitable for restoration. A professional can assist evaluate your particular situation.
2. What is the typical cost of window restoration services?
The expense can vary widely based on elements like the type of window, degree of damage, and area. On average, homeowners can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 100 to ₤ 800 per window for restoration services.
3. The length of time does window restoration usually take?
The duration of the restoration process depends upon the level of the damage and the variety of windows included. On average, most restoration jobs can be completed within a few hours to a number of days.
4. Can window restoration improve energy performance?
Yes, brought back windows can considerably improve energy efficiency, especially when weatherstripping is included or replaced, and broken glass is repaired.
5. Are there service warranties offered for restoration services?
Many credible restoration companies provide warranties that cover both labor and materials. It's important to ask about service warranty alternatives before proceeding with any service.
